The six paths framework in formulating blue ocean strategy are 1 look across alternative industries, 2 look across strategic groups within industry, 3look across buyer groups, 4 look across complementary product and service offerings, 5look across the functionalemotional orientation of an industry and 5look across time to shape trends.
